Why Choose Boyne City for Your Next Home?
Scenic Beauty & Lake Charlevoix Proximity
Boyne City hugs the southeast corner of Lake Charlevoix—one of Michigan’s crown jewels. Lakeview Condominiums offer front-row seats to some of the most scenic water views in the state, with easy access to boating, kayaking, and swimming.
Four-Season Lifestyle
From summer lakeside lounging to skiing at nearby Boyne Mountain in winter, Boyne City delivers all four seasons in spectacular fashion. This variety keeps both full-time residents and seasonal visitors coming back for more.
Booming Real Estate Demand
With rising demand for waterfront property in Northern Michigan, Lakeview condos offer a unique blend of lifestyle and long-term investment potential. Inventory is tight, which helps preserve and elevate property values.
Overview of Lakeview Condominiums
Location & Setting
Lakeview Condominiums are ideally situated just a stone’s throw from downtown Boyne City and Lake Charlevoix. You can stroll to shops, restaurants, and weekly farmers markets in minutes.
Architectural Design & Styles
These condos range in style from charming craftsman aesthetics to contemporary coastal designs, offering a tasteful blend of form and function. Many include large windows, open-concept living, and private balconies.
Floor Plans & Layout Options
Units typically range from 2 to 4 bedrooms, with square footage between 1,000 and 2,500 square feet. Some include lofts or bonus rooms, which are perfect for remote work, guest stays, or hobby space.

Purchasing a Condo: Step-by-Step Guide
Budgeting & Financing Options
Condo financing can be different than traditional home loans, especially if the development is considered a condotel. Work with lenders familiar with Northern Michigan real estate.
Finding the Right Real Estate Agent
Partner with a local expert like Brook Walsh of BrookWalsh.com, who knows the ins and outs of the Lakeview market.
Navigating HOA Rules and Fees
Each unit may have different rules regarding rentals, pets, and renovations. Be sure to review the bylaws and HOA disclosures thoroughly before purchasing.

Maintenance & Management Insights
HOA Responsibilities
Your HOA fee covers snow removal, landscaping, exterior maintenance, and sometimes utilities—offering worry-free living.
Owner Responsibilities
Interior unit maintenance, insurance, and updates to décor or furnishings fall under your care.
Interior Design Tips for Lakeview Condos
Lean into nautical themes with whites, blues, and natural wood tones. Use space-saving furniture and oversized windows to let in the natural light.
Comparing New vs. Resale Condos at Lakeview
Newer units offer modern upgrades but may come at a premium. Resale units might need cosmetic updates but could offer better value and established rental histories.
